In 1893, Millicent Catherine Florence Joyce entered the world in Lambeth, London, born to Theodore Alberto Reed Pinaud And Florence. In 1901, Millicent Catherine Florence Joyce resided in Lambeth, London, England. Millicent Catherine Florence Joyce married William Henry Joyce, and had children including Joan Laura Millicent Joyce. Millicent Catherine Florence Joyce passed away in 1968 in Lambeth, Surry, England.
